Transaction 61642cdcb2d541441fb3dd4428fa5f3ea9c1eb0f49a6a5924407670b73e40a84

2 Input
2 Outputs
  • 61642cdcb2d541441fb3dd4428fa5f3ea9c1eb0f49a6a5924407670b73e40a84:0
  • value  95208
    address  16pK2fTTLjDh72XA4jpucS62xbERGubLfh
  • 61642cdcb2d541441fb3dd4428fa5f3ea9c1eb0f49a6a5924407670b73e40a84:1
  • value  4061552
    address  3HjDMkCTXrUWcN1PwJP1UFQCBaH3qJYG9X